Image files

A

Adobe software supports various image file formats, the main ones are
JPEG: good for web images
PNG: supports transparency, good for web images
GIF: Supports animations and transparency
TIFF: often used for printing
PSD: Photoshop file, keeps layers and editing options
Vector formats (scalable, shape-based), AI: adobe illustrator file is a fully editable vector format

Gradients (different types)

A

Linear gradient: Colors bend in a straight line
Radial gradient: Colors bend outward from a center point
Freeform gradient: Allows custom bending with multiple color points
